... the war on terror isn't a war by pretty much any definition of war you want to use. It's a PR buzzword that's entirely unrepresentative of the actions involved with the effort, so... terrible, terrible example. Specific acts or situations related to it have erupted into war, but the general movement is... no. Low intensity conflicts in general, which are usually your primary hotbed for terrorist action, do have incredible amounts of difficulty meeting any particular just war definition, for what that's worth.

Though I did just realize it's kinda' amusing that jihad would actually be a pretty darn accurate term to use for the so-called war on terror. Especially the more ideological aspects of it really kinda' fits the whole thing to a T...
